How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 14425?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 14425 Studio Apartments | $1,150 | $1,090 | $1,210 |
| 14425 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,296 | $700 | $2,846 |
| 14425 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,802 | $800 | $2,948 |
| 14425 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,368 | $1,725 | $3,287 |
| 14425 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,095 | $1,995 | $2,195 |
